Marketing confirmed the campaign schedule is on track, with retail partners in Hartvale and Ossington briefed. Production reported tooling complete and first batches passing inspection. Pricing was approved as proposed, subject to final board sign-off. Risks discussed included freight delays and a competitor announcement expected next month; mitigation plans were noted. Distribution agreements remain under negotiation. The strategic rationale and revenue assumptions are summarised in the confidential note below.

management briefing: The renewal with Zoraelax Group closes at $10 million a year, 15 percent below the last contract. Project Ralael slips by six weeks because of the audit delay.

Team — visitor basics at Thornleaf House front desk. All guests sign in on the tablet, get a printed sticker, and wait in the lounge until collected by their host. No escorting guests yourself. Deliveries go to the side hatch, never the lobby. Lost stickers mean a fresh sign-in, no shortcuts. To release the inner lobby door for a collected visitor, use the desk keypad with the code below.

door code, yagap-bahof: bdg-O-05

Overall the scheduler logic in `backfill_runner` looks sound, but please move these magic numbers out of the loop body and into module-level constants. Future maintainers will need to adjust the retry ceiling and window size when the Lanternfall dataset doubles next quarter, and hunting through the dispatch code for inline values is error-prone. Also add a one-line comment on why the concurrency cap exists (the warehouse connection pool). I'd suggest defining them like this.

tuning table, yajog-yahof:
BUDGETS = {
    "lamvan": 303,
    "wenox": 460,
    "fenvan": 525,
}

## SQL Linting — Ferndeck Repo

All `.sql` files pass through sqlgate before merge. Rules: uppercase keywords, no `SELECT *`, explicit joins, trailing semicolons. CI blocks violations; no overrides without a waiver from the data lead. To unlock the lint-config vault for waiver edits, authenticate with the recovery passphrase shown directly below this line.

vault phrase of tajeg-tageg = pelix-druix-holius-briael-zorwyn-frawyn-fraox-norok-drueth-aldiel